Tetracyclines

open access: yesMedical Clinics of North America, 1995
Publisher Summary This chapter reviews tetracyclines. The tetracyclines belong to the class of antibiotics known as polyketides. The main types of tetracyclines in everyday clinical use differ only in the functional groups at three positions, namely, C-5, C-6, and C-7, on the antibiotic backbone.

Tetracycline Allergy [PDF]

open access: yesPharmacy, 2019
Despite the widespread use of tetracycline antibiotics since the late 1940s, tetracycline hypersensitivity reactions have rarely been described in the literature. A comprehensive PubMed search was performed, including allergic and serious adverse reactions attributed to the tetracyclines class of antibiotics.
